rdfs:comment | Ahwai, or Ndunic, constitutes a branch of the Plateau languages of Nigeria. Blench (2008) notes three clearly but distinct Ndunic languages, Nandu Ndun, Ningon Nyeng, and Tari Shakara. However, that year Ethnologue reclassified them as a single language called Ahwai. ('en' language string) |
